I'm trying to plot the wave equation in 3D but I'm getting an error with the array size for e.
This is the error it's giving me:
"Arrays have incompatible sizes for this operation. Error in PHYS225_Project (line 36) e = sin(w.*t.*z);"
If anyone can help me make my code work I'f greatly appreicate it.
Here's my code:
clear all
clc
close all
% Define the parameters
xo = 1;
yo = 1;
v = 5;
Lx = 50;
Ly = 50;
n = 0:1:10;
m = 0:1:10;
% Compute the wave vector and frequency
[kx, ky] = meshgrid(n*pi/Lx, m*pi/Ly);
w = v * sqrt(kx.^2 + ky.^2);
% Define the time and space grids
t = 0:0.5:10;
z = 0:0.5:10;
[x, y] = meshgrid(0:Lx/50:Lx, 0:Ly/50:Ly);
% Compute the wave equation solution
a = sin(n*pi*xo/Lx);
b = sin(m*pi*yo/Ly);
a_mat = repmat(a.', [1, length(m)]);
b_mat = repmat(b, [length(n), 1]);
% c = sin(kx.*x);
c = sin(reshape(x,1,[]).'*kx(:).');
% d = sin(ky.*y);
d = sin(reshape(y,1,[]).'*ky(:).');
